Ed Reed To Visit The Texans

According to a recent report by the Baltimore Sun, Ed Reed is due to visit the Houston Texans Thursday. This comes after the Baltimore Ravens have already lost a myriad of key free-agents such as Paul Kruger, Dannell Ellerbe, and Bernard Pollard. As a Ravens fan I can only hope that this is a parallel to the Ray Lewis free-agent situation when he visited Dallas just to see what he was worth before re-signing with the Ravens.

However I am going to play the role of purple-blasphemer and say that the Baltimore Ravens would NOT be decimated without Ed Reed. In fact, I think Ed's been playing past his prime for a few years now and the Ravens would be a bit better off with a younger safety. It seemed as if Ed was always getting hurt over the last two years and seemed a bit timid when tackling recently. While it would suck to lose Reed I do not think it would be the end of the world. On that note, however, I hope he re-signs so he can retire as a Raven.
